Asphalt Road Surfacing : Techniques and Best Approaches
The laying of tarmacadam road construction requires careful preparation and adherence to proven techniques . Generally, the work begins with thorough site clearing , including the removal of existing material and the stabilization of the sub-base. Base course layers are then laid and consolidated to ensure a stable foundation. The tarmacadam compound itself – a mixture of aggregate and bitumen – is processed to the correct heat before being distributed and smoothed in uniform sections. Superior control assessments throughout the build are vital to guarantee a resilient and secure road surface . Best practices also highlight proper drainage and the use of appropriate tools for effective delivery and lifespan of the road.

Green Road Surfacing Alternatives
The growing pressure for eco-conscious construction methods is fueling innovation in road surfacing . Traditional tarmacadam, while long-lasting, often relies on polluting processes . Thankfully, multiple innovative solutions are arising that significantly minimize the carbon impact . These include :
- Upcycled Asphalt Mix: Utilizing scrap asphalt from removed roads.
- Porous Pavement: Allowing rainfall to drain through, lessening surface and restoring groundwater.
- Plant-derived Binders: Replacing traditional bitumen with compounds from sustainable supplies.
- Reduced-emission Concrete Mixes : Incorporating alternative materials to lower cement content, a significant source to emissions
Embracing these sustainable surfacing approaches is crucial for building a increasingly eco-responsible world for roadways .
